  • Publication number: 20150292603
    Abstract: A pulley device for a belt or chain, the pulley device comprising a bearing provided with an external ring, an internal ring, and at least one row of rolling elements mounted in a bearing chamber defined between the external and internal rings. A pulley is secured in rotation with the external ring and provided with an external radial surface for engaging with a belt or chain. Also included is at least one hollow shaft able to receive a screw for mounting the pulley device on a support. The hollow shaft forming a structural unit comprising a bushing, a flange secured to the bushing, and which extends, from the bushing, radially outwards, respective to a central axis of the hollow shaft, as far as the bearing chamber. The flange is formed with a washer and an endplate, while the washer is radially located between the bushing and the endplate.

  • Publication number: 20060202387
    Abstract: The channel cleaning brush comprises a flexible core (10) on which at least one brush (15) is mounted, which is formed by a shaft (20) and a cleaning coil disposed on the shaft, which comprises fins (21) regularly disposed on the shaft (20). The brushes are over-moulded on the core.
